Enhancing Aluminium Processing with CNC Technology
The integration of Computer Numerical Control technology has dramatically revolutionized the landscape of aluminium processing. Traditionally, working with aluminium – a metal known for its unique properties and tendency to distort – posed significant problems. CNC machining offer unparalleled exactness, minimizing waste and enabling the creation of intricate, high-tolerance parts. By employing complex toolpaths and adaptive feed rates, CNC machines can expertly handle the aluminum’s softness, diminishing the risk of burrs and ensuring a consistently high-quality surface. Moreover, this strategy facilitates faster production periods and allows for greater flexibility in design, opening new avenues for innovation in industries like aerospace and building.
